A company receives shipments from two factories. Depending on the size of the order, a shipment can be in 1 box for a small order, 2 boxes for a medium order, 3 boxes for a large order. The company has two different suppliers. Factory Q is 60 miles from the company. Factory R is 180 miles from the company. An experiment consists of monitoring a shipment and observing B, the number of boxes, and M, the number of miles the shipment travels. The following probabity model describes the experiment:
Factory Q Factory R
small order 0.3 0.2
medium order 0.1 0.2
large order 0.1 0.1
a. Find PB M(b, m), the joint PMF of the number of boxes and the distance.
b. What is E[B], the expected number of boxes?
c. Are B and M independent?
